Transaction 89c70d31d4cbe316c12e7a26e5e32895630db62b6a31f740b3cdf971b8fa8029

1 Input
2 Outputs
  • 89c70d31d4cbe316c12e7a26e5e32895630db62b6a31f740b3cdf971b8fa8029:0
  • value  7866281
    address  38X9ztKDkJTKsHX7kYs5acvHAsTboYhT9t
  • 89c70d31d4cbe316c12e7a26e5e32895630db62b6a31f740b3cdf971b8fa8029:1
  • value  1392789022
    address  bc1qfgg595qcg0dl3tqxd939mspuvq5wqt3wh29tp7